Commit Graph

26 Commits

Author SHA1 Message Date
DL6ER
4a470ce47e Add message types LOAD, SHMEM and DISK to Pi-hole diagnosis system (#1989)
Signed-off-by: DL6ER <dl6er@dl6er.de>
2021-11-30 12:13:04 +01:00
Christian König
78aace3403 Revert "Remove duplicated code as it is already part of utils.stateLoadCallback"
This reverts commit 395b1b6c1f.

Signed-off-by: Christian König <ckoenig@posteo.de>
2021-11-14 22:38:18 +01:00
DL6ER
ecbaaca000 Add pretty-printing for message type DNSMASQ_WARN (#1973)
* Add pretty-printing for message type DNSMASQ_WARN

Signed-off-by: DL6ER <dl6er@dl6er.de>

* Fix prettier

Signed-off-by: Christian König <ckoenig@posteo.de>

Co-authored-by: Christian König <ckoenig@posteo.de>
2021-11-13 13:16:46 +01:00
yubiuser
5aeb52ee50 Merge pull request #1948 from pi-hole/tweak/datatables
Tweak to datatables column rendering
2021-10-28 20:21:01 +02:00
yubiuser
98ec9ee2fc Set stateDuration to 0 for all saved datatables to store the state indefinitely (#1944)
* Set stateDuration to 0 for all saved datatables to store the state indefinite

Signed-off-by: Christian König <ckoenig@posteo.de>

* Move stateDuration to utils.js

Signed-off-by: Christian König <ckoenig@posteo.de>

* Remove duplicated code as it is already part of utils.stateLoadCallback

Signed-off-by: Christian König <ckoenig@posteo.de>

* Fix function

Signed-off-by: Christian König <ckoenig@posteo.de>

* Revert "Fix function"

This reverts commit 2f54f5f988.

Signed-off-by: Christian König <ckoenig@posteo.de>

* Revert "Move stateDuration to utils.js"

This reverts commit 6a3e7786bc.

Signed-off-by: Christian König <ckoenig@posteo.de>
2021-10-27 20:06:02 +01:00
Adam Warner
0e483a8eea Force all columns in any declared datatable to render using datatables render.text function to prevent possible (very low risk, requiring authenticated dashboard anyway) XSS.
Signed-off-by: Adam Warner <me@adamwarner.co.uk>
2021-10-27 19:49:46 +01:00
yubiuser
e0ba6ded2a Address review comments
Signed-off-by: yubiuser <ckoenig@posteo.de>
2021-09-12 19:42:34 +02:00
yubiuser
086a8dabbb Fix xo
Signed-off-by: yubiuser <ckoenig@posteo.de>
2021-09-12 19:42:25 +02:00
DL6ER
4faa77da39 Add interpretation for Pi-hole message type RATE_LIMIT
Signed-off-by: DL6ER <dl6er@dl6er.de>
2021-09-12 19:42:14 +02:00
yubiuser
29fbb3379f Fix prettier
Signed-off-by: yubiuser <ckoenig@posteo.de>
2021-09-12 19:41:30 +02:00
yubiuser
9aaa45a034 Add delete button to message table
Signed-off-by: yubiuser <ckoenig@posteo.de>
2021-09-12 19:41:15 +02:00
DL6ER
c77f104072 Add interpretation for Pi-hole message type RATE_LIMIT
Signed-off-by: DL6ER <dl6er@dl6er.de>
2021-08-06 21:35:51 +02:00
DL6ER
0d0a8dba67 Change prettier option trailingComma from "none" to the new default "es5" (see https://prettier.io/docs/en/options.html#trailing-commas)
Signed-off-by: DL6ER <dl6er@dl6er.de>
2021-06-23 11:26:43 +02:00
XhmikosR
cf6a59d63f Disable a few xo rules for now.
Signed-off-by: XhmikosR <xhmikosr@gmail.com>
2021-04-13 19:25:35 +00:00
DL6ER
5e808765e3 Print fatal dnsmasq errors
Signed-off-by: DL6ER <dl6er@dl6er.de>
2020-11-17 22:41:00 +01:00
Adam Warner
075c474fbc Use new Array().join() for space generation.
Signed-off-by: Adam Warner <me@adamwarner.co.uk>
2020-06-03 20:32:55 +01:00
DL6ER
1df85ff7a9 Simplify code for space generation and use HTML entities.
Signed-off-by: DL6ER <dl6er@dl6er.de>
2020-06-03 18:05:30 +01:00
DL6ER
c45bcd9d8e Add support for HOSTNAME diagnostics message
Signed-off-by: DL6ER <dl6er@dl6er.de>
2020-06-03 18:05:30 +01:00
Adam Warner
105d880473 final null check on stateLoadCallBack (#1411)
Signed-off-by: Adam Warner <me@adamwarner.co.uk>
2020-05-30 17:52:34 +03:00
XhmikosR
cecb5aa88c Use $(fn)
This is the recommended way in jQuery 3.x.

Signed-off-by: XhmikosR <xhmikosr@gmail.com>
2020-05-30 10:24:55 +03:00
Adam Warner
3957e9eef1 Move some duplicated code to utils.js
Signed-off-by: Adam Warner <me@adamwarner.co.uk>
2020-05-23 11:04:30 +03:00
XhmikosR
0fa7de82b0 JS: Enforce camelcase.
It's a common convention to use camelcase for variable names.

Signed-off-by: XhmikosR <xhmikosr@gmail.com>
2020-05-23 10:29:44 +03:00
DL6ER
f591280d58 Review comments
Signed-off-by: DL6ER <dl6er@dl6er.de>
2020-05-17 16:07:22 +03:00
DL6ER
0d834b9b1c Fix domain management JS error.
Signed-off-by: DL6ER <dl6er@dl6er.de>
2020-05-17 16:07:21 +03:00
DL6ER
4a29d93a2f Add support for SUBNET messages.
Signed-off-by: DL6ER <dl6er@dl6er.de>
2020-05-17 16:07:21 +03:00
DL6ER
b0f54f5451 Add new Pi-hole diagnostics page.
Signed-off-by: DL6ER <dl6er@dl6er.de>
2020-05-17 16:07:21 +03:00